Finish 100 days of guitar practice on GiveIt100.comIf you’ve never heard of GiveIt100, it’s a website that lets you upload a 10-second video of you working on a skill once a day. It doesn’t have to be 100 days in a row, so that works for a busy, stressed person like me. People use it for things like weight loss—you see people on day 1 who were pretty large, and by the 100th day they look happier, healthier, and so much more confident in their own skin. The founder of the site taught herself to dance in 100 days. The progress is pretty cool to watch. ANYways, all that to say: I’m using it to help motivate me to learn the guitar. So far I’ve got 3 videos up, and I’m hoping to reach day 100 this year. Even after just a few practice sessions I’ve improved so much, and I can’t imagine how pleased I’ll be with myself if I reach day 100.
